Lua error in package.lua at line 80: module 'strict' not found. A cromlêh is a megalithic altar-tomb, made of rough stone.[1] They are distinguished from Cromlechs by being located within a stone circle. William Borlase denoted the terminology in 1769. A good example is at Carn Llechart.[2]
